Programs for Adults

March

Tax Preparation with AARP

Saturdays, February 4th-April 15th, 12:00pm-4:00pm
Let the AARP Tax Aides help you navigate the confusing world of personal taxes. Bring all necessary tax documents. Walk-in appointments only. For more information please refer to our website.

Garden City Community Legal Clinic

March 16th, 4:00-6:00pm

IVLP recruits attorneys from local communities who volunteer their time and expertise through advice and counsel on your civil legal matter.
You will be called when you have a confirmed time slot.  Visit https://laserfiche.isb.idaho.gov/Forms/ClinicReg to register or scan the QR code. 

The Women’s & Children’s Alliance

Monthly on the 3rd Wednesday, March 15th, 1:30-3:30pm
The WCA operates shelters, provides counseling, legal advocacy, and crisis services to survivors of domestic and sexual abuse.  For more information, visit www.wcaboise.org.

Fit and Fall Proof™: Senior Fitness Class

Tuesdays & Thursdays at 11:00am, Saturdays 10:15am
Improve your strength, mobility, and balance to reduce risk of falling. Pick up and return waivers at the library. Registration is required.  Please call (208)-472-2942 to register.

Qigong

Wednesdays at 11:00am, *no class 4/19

Qigong is an ancient Chinese health practice similar to Tai Chi in which you engage your mind, body, and spirit in a gentle way. Pick up and return waivers at the front desk. Registration is required.   Call 208-472-2942.

Senior Bingo

Last Wednesdays / 3:00pm
March 29th

Join in the Bingo fun, just for seniors. Meet new people and play for prizes!

Book Club

Thursday, March 9th / 2:00pm
Book:  Such a Fun Age, by Kiley Reid

 

April

Holds Locker Grand Opening Celebration

Have you heard about our new Holds Locker in Riverfront Park? Join us as we celebrate National Library Week with our Grand Opening Celebration! We will have pizza, games, a bounce house, and lots of fun! Come learn what the Garden City Public Library has to offer and sign up for your library card. This celebration will be held at the location of the Holds Locker.

Wednesday, April 26th, 5:30-7:00pm, All Ages. Riverfront Park: E. 42nd St in Garden City, 83714

Home Gardening Series–Backyard Chickens for Beginners

Tuesday, April 4th, 6:00pm
Has the recent egg shortage got you thinking about raising your own flock in your backyard? Or, always wanted to, but haven’t a clue where to begin? This class will help get you get started, and beyond! Join us for tips & tricks from National Backyard Chicken Advocate & Author, Gretchen Anderson.

Yoga and You

Saturday, April 22nd, 1:00-4:00pm

This workshop is focused on the mindful body in this space and our awareness of breath to experience the mindful body. We will work on body, mind, and breath to get a clear understanding to bring awareness to the space we share in this beautiful planet.  Facilitated by Sudeep, a certified Yoga Therapist visiting from India.  Registration required.
